Core Set 2020 Chase Cards: Top 10 Most Valuable
M20 · Core ·2019-07-12 · Other 2019 sets
These are the ten most valuable Core Set 2020 cards by current USD market price. Field of the Dead currently leads the set at $31.74. For a mainline Magic release, the leaders usually combine constructed demand, Commander play and collector interest in the exact printing.
Ranked by the exact printing, not by card name across all sets. Prices move with the market; data last updated 2026-04-17.

How the ranking works
Price is attached to the printing.
A Magic card can appear in many sets, finishes and frame treatments. This list uses the individual Core Set 2020 printing and ranks the available non-foil USD price for that printing. It does not transfer the price of an older or rarer version onto this set.
A chase card is simply one of the cards collectors currently pursue most strongly in this release. Competitive play, Commander demand, rarity and premium art can all affect the order, and a future reprint can change it.
